Bourj and Nejmeh drew in the first game of the Federation Cup

Nejmeh - Bourj 0-0

Saturday, 1 July 2023, 5 pm local time (2 pm UTC), Amin Abdelnour Stadium, Bhamdoun (Aley), Lebanon, first round of the Federation Cup, Group D.

This year, the Lebanese Football Association decided to replace the former Elite and Challenge cups with a single competition, involving all the 12 teams of the Lebanese Premier League, called the Federation Cup. The 12 teams were distributed into four groups of 3 teams, and the winners of each group qualify for the semifinals.

Group D seems to be the toughest one, as it includes three powerful clubs, Nejmeh, Bourj and Safa.

In the first match of the group, Nejmeh and Bourj drew 0-0 after a rather boring game, with few goalscoring situations. Nejmeh missed no less than 7 players who were called up for either the senior national team or the olympic national team of Lebanon, while Bourj also missed a couple of players for the same reason. It was a good opportunity for the other players to make themselves noticed to the managers and the public. 

However, both teams transferred many players recently and the level of homogeneity is still low, and, on the other hand, the preparations for the 2023-2024 season have just begun.

Bourj FC (with Youssef Anbar #77 in the foreground) had more opportunities. Photo source: Bourj FC Facebook page

While Nejmeh enjoyed certain periods of domination in the midfield and in terms of ball possession, Bourj FC had the biggest opportunities to score a goal, especially in the second half. Houssem Louati created a few chances, and the best of them came in the 72nd minute, when he entered a box and passed to Mohamad Zein Tahan to his left, but Tahan's shot was blocked.

Unfortunately, except for Houssem Louati, the other Bourj offensive players did not provide much in this game, and the management would have to think about a foreign striker, because Derrick's performance was average at best. The midfield also suffered a lot in front of less experienced Nejmeh players.

The most important event of the game was that Youssef Anbar suffered an injury in the 80th minute and he will undergo yet another surgery, so he will be out for some time once again.

Bourj starting line-up: Ali Halal - Mohamad El Dor, Khodor Hallak, Shadi Skaf, Youssef Anbar - Mohamad El Faour, Mohamad Sibaii "Wartan" - Mohamad Saleh, Bilal Al Sabbagh, Houssem Louati - Derrick. Seeveral players were introduced in the second half, such as: Abou Baker Al Mel, Mohamed Zein Tahan, Hassan Chaito "Moni", Ibrahim Hammoudi. Manager: Hussein Tahan.

The second match of the group, Nejmeh - Safa, will be played today, while the last match of the group, Bourj - Safa, will be played next Wednesday, 12 July 2023.

During the transfer period (which is not yet over), Bourj FC performed a series of transfers, meant to improve the squad for the 2023-2024. The following players have been brought so far: goalkeeper Ali Halal (from Nejmeh), centre back Mohamad Al Husseini (from Al Ahed), wing back Mohamad Zein Tahan (from Safa), winger Abou Baker Al Mel (returning after a loan spell to Hikma / La Sagesse), central midfielder Bilal Al Sabbagh (from Al Ahed), Tunisian offensive midfielder Houssem Louati (from Ansar), forward Ali Kassas (from Nejmeh), Syrian centre back Ahmed Al Saleh (from Al Jaish, Syria), and midfielder Hassan Chaito "Moni" (from Nejmeh). Only two of them are foreigners, Houssem Louati and Ahmed Al Saleh, and there is place for two more foreigners in the squad, as the Lebanese FA allow four foreigners beginning with the 2023-2024 season. One of them might be the striker from Guinea, Derrick, whose performance so far was not convincing, but he still has a chance to prove his qualities. An Egyptian player was also training with the team, but he will most likely not be part of the squad for the next season. Several players from the youth team have been also promoted to the senior team.

All these players are also meant to replace those (14) who have left Bourj FC during the transfer period. Among those who left are the following players: goalkeepers Hassan Moghnieh (to Shabab Al Ghazieh) and Afif Zreik, centre back Richard Baffour (to Shabab Sahel), left back Mohammad Hammoud, midfielders Mohamad Safwan and Mohamad Omar Sadek (both to Nejmeh), playmakers Khaled Takaji and Youssef Barakat, wingers Hussein Al Outa and Mahmoud Kawar, forwards Ali Hammoud and Mohamad Nassereddine, as well as foreign strikers Dennis Tetteh and Stephen Sarfo. Some of these players, especially Richard Baffour, Mohamad Sadek, Khaled Takaji, and Dennis Tetteh have been instrumental for Bourj FC in the previous season and it will be difficult to find players of similar value. One or two foreign strikers are very much needed, and perhaps a creative midfielder, a "number 10" to replace Khaled Takaji.
